How they compare
MDG: Western Asia currently reports 86.8% against 61.8% in Nicaragua, a difference of 25.0%.
That makes MDG: Western Asia's figure about 1.4 times Nicaragua's.
Across all 5 years both countries report, MDG: Western Asia has been ahead every year.
MDG: Western Asia ranks 61st and Nicaragua ranks 62nd of 200 groups.
MDG: Western Asia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
